#77c7e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77c7e4 is composed of 46.7% red, 78%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 196 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 68%. #77c7e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#008fc9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#77c7e4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#77c7e4 has RGB values of R:119, G:199,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7849956.

Hex triplet 77c7e4 #77c7e4
RGB Decimal 119, 199, 228 rgb(119,199,228)
RGB Percent 46.7, 78, 89.4 rgb(46.7%,78%,89.4%)
CMYK 48, 13, 0, 11
HSL 196°, 66.9, 68 hsl(196,66.9%,68%)
HSV (or HSB) 196°, 47.8, 89.4
Web Safe 66cccc #66cccc
CIE-LAB 76.294, -16.888, -22.018
XYZ 42.031, 50.368, 80.902
xyY 0.243, 0.291, 50.368
CIE-LCH 76.294, 27.749, 232.51
CIE-LUV 76.294, -35.924, -32.301
Hunter-Lab 70.97, -18.484, -17.908
Binary 01110111, 11000111, 11100100

Shades and Tints of #77c7e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090b is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#77c7e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9b0b2 is the less saturated color, while #5ed3fd is the most saturated one.
